  12. We have been watching episodes of Scam City on the travel channel. Very interesting! Last one was Barcelona. Shows how they do it. Pickpockets are working in groups- while one picks at your purse/pocket/bag, another walks behind him and sometimes others to your sides.Blocks others from seeing it happen. Do not carry purses or bags including duffle bags, to your side! They recommend ladies wear cross body purses and in front of you with one hand on it alwaysl Watch out for them going up stairs, escalators. Also gives examples of distractions and "accidentally" bumping into you!

    Most of the fulltime thieves are well known to police, but regardless of the number of arrests the punishment is still only 3 days in jail plus fine. They make enough in a day to not even worry about it. Perhaps we all need to write letters to spanish govt to change the laws!
